Sheikh Hasina’s Son Accuses Pakistan’s ISI of Instigating Unrest in Bangladesh

In a recent interview, Sajeeb Wazed Joy, son of former Bangladeshi Prime Minister Sheikh Hasina, claimed that Pakistan’s intelligence agency, the Inter-Services Intelligence Agency (ISI), is instigating unrest in Bangladesh.

Joy voiced these concerns amidst his mother’s uncertain political future, stating that while Sheikh Hasina will return to Bangladesh, her role, whether as an active politician or in retirement, remains undecided.

Joy also expressed gratitude toward Indian Prime Minister Narendra Modi and his administration for protecting his mother during these turbulent times. He appealed for India’s support in rallying international forces to restore democratic governance in Bangladesh.

Accusing the ISI of deliberate interference, Joy stated that the agency’s actions have exacerbated the political instability, likening the situation to that in Afghanistan. He criticized the interim government led by Nobel laureate Mohammad Yunus for failing to maintain law and order, urging it to facilitate a fair electoral process once democracy is reinstated.

Furthermore, Joy dismissed rumours of his family seeking asylum or his mother’s U.S. visa being revoked as baseless. He emphasized the necessity of reinstating democracy to ensure his mother’s return and the continuation of the Awami League’s political legacy.”
